Hong Kong, China vs Japan: Carbon Cost to Revenues in Disclosing Firms, Adjusted by Growth
Carbon Cost to Revenues in Disclosing Firms, Adjusted by Growth over time
- Hong Kong, China
- Japan
How they compare
Hong Kong, China currently reports 0.5829 against 0.5124 in Japan, a difference of 0.0705.
That makes Hong Kong, China's figure about 1.1 times Japan's.
Across all 26 years both countries report, Hong Kong, China has been ahead every year.
Hong Kong, China ranks 25th and Japan ranks 27th of 39 countries.
Hong Kong, China has averaged higher in every one of the 4 decades both report.

About this data
This dataset measures the impact of evolving carbon costs on firms’ financial indicators under different transition scenarios. The impacts are aggregated across countries and industries. Carbon Cost to Revenues/Assets indicators give an indication of how high these taxes will be in alternative policy scenarios in comparison to revenues/assets of the disclosing firms, along the transition through 2050. Revenues/Assets at risk indicator shows the share of firms that are expected to be severely impacted by carbon costs under the selected transition scenarios. Each indicator is calculated under two different assumptions: i) constant assets/revenues; and ii) adjusted by growth factors.
